Camelback had to start their season on the road on Monday, and it wasn't the start they were hoping for. They fell 43-36 to the Mountain View Mountain Lions.
Defeat or not, Camelback got some senior leadership from Kyliana Massey and Deja Francisco. Massey posted 18 points in addition to six rebounds and six steals, while Francisco earned eight points and 11 boards.
Madelyn Alejandro had an outrageously good game for Mountain View as she dropped a double-double with 19 points and 17 boards.
Mountain View has started the season off flawlessly and has a 2-0 record to show for it.
Camelback didn't take long to hit the court again: they've already played their next game, a 58-45 loss against Marcos de Niza on the 25th. As for Mountain View, they also wasted no time getting back out on the court and have already played their next matchup, a 60-38 defeat against Cicero Prep Academy on the 25th.
